Croatia Airlines in line for state support to stabilise carrier

In the aftermath of the collapse of Adria Airways, the neighbouring Croatian govt is seeking to avert a similar risk to Croatia Airlines after setting out conditions for a capital injection. Prime minister Andrej Plenkovic has set out the conditions in relation to an initial Kn100m (US$14.8m), which it describes as the "first part" of a Kn250m advance necessary to stabilise operations at the airline. Croatia Airlines had disclosed Sept 19 that the govt had approved a decision on creating prerequisites for a Kn250m recapitalisation. Plenkovic recently cautioned that the Croatian carrier needed to be "financially ready" for the next stage and that the govt had embarked on a strategic partnership process for the carrier. <br/>
